AMC Theatres plans to increase the number of commercials and ads shown before its movies begin. The change was announced by AMC CEO Adam Aron during a recent earnings call.
Here are the key points:
- The Goal is More Revenue: The primary reason for this change is to increase the company's revenue.
- Comparison to Europe: Aron justified the decision by pointing out that European cinemas often run 30-40 minutes of ads, suggesting that AMC—with its current 15-20 minute pre-show—has room for growth.
- A "Thoughtful" Increase: The increase will not be drastic. Aron stated they will be "thoughtful" and add just "a few more minutes" of commercials to the existing pre-show.
- Placement of Ads: These new commercials will be added to the pre-show block (like the "Noovie" segment) and will run before the movie trailers start.
